Business Services Industry
Wind River's Tornado — The Most Dramatic Advance in Embedded Systems Technology in 10 Years — For UNIX and Windows; Target Resource Constraints No Longer an Issue for Powerful Development Tools
Business Wire, Sept 4, 1995
ALAMEDA, Calif.--(BUSINESS WIRE)--Sept. 4, 1995--Wind River Systems (NASDAQ:WIND) today introduced Tornado -- the first open and extensible environment for developing real-time and embedded systems -- for UNIX and Windows.
Tornado provides embedded system developers with a complete set of powerful, intuitive, graphical tools to improve productivity. From low-end, deeply-embedded communications and office automation products to high-end VME applications such as real-time industrial automation and traffic control systems, Tornado will enable developers to get high-quality products to market faster.
"With Tornado, embedded system developers will have the same fully integrated visual programming environment for any project regardless of target memory constraints, resource limitations, or real-time requirements," said David Larrimore, vice president of marketing for Wind River Systems. "Companies producing a variety of embedded products -- each with special development requirements -- will dramatically improve their effectiveness and productivity by choosing Tornado as their standard corporate-wide development environment."
Tornado - A New Standard for Embedded Development
Embedded software can be extremely complex, with hundreds of system objects all co-existing and operating both synchronously and asynchronously. The embedded software developer must often meet severe memory and I/O constraints while at the same time trying to increase productivity and improve performance. Until now, most of the tools available to handle this complexity have been stand-alone and text-based.
Tornado provides the embedded developer a new interactive cross-development environment comprised of coordinated tools that incur little or no overhead in target resources. This new development environment consists of three integrated components: the Tornado tool suite, a set of powerful tools and utilities on both the host and the target; VxWorks, the industry's most powerful and scalable real-time operating system, which executes on the embedded target processor; and a full range of communications options such as Ethernet, serial line, ICE or ROM emulator for the target connection to the host.
"Wind River's products have always defined the state-of-the-art for embedded and real-time development," said Wind River chairman and co-founder Jerry Fiddler. "Tornado's highly-integrated, scalable and open architecture continues this trend by giving developers access to the market's most powerful tools, and the ability to easily adapt the development environment to the problem at hand."
A key differentiator is Tornado's integrated target and tool management facility, which is used to access all host tools, make connections to the targets, monitor active development sessions and choose configuration options.
Tornado Tool Suite - All Tools For All Targets
Unique to Tornado is the fact that all the development tools can be utilized at any stage of application development, with any level of target system resources, and over any physical connection. The Tornado tool suite offers a host-based shell and incremental linking loader allowing powerful development functionality without requiring target resources. A host-based browser is available for point-and-click monitoring of all aspects of the target system. The CrossWind debugger supports task aware and system level debugging, and mixed source and assembly displays. The new WindConfig tool allows the run-time system to be configured and built graphically. Finally, a target server is available for performing object module and symbol-table manipulations entirely on the host as well as handling the details of connection to the target over any physical media.
The philosophy that underlies this new architecture is a careful abstraction of the essential services that must be performed on the target. These services are encapsulated in Tornado's single target-resident component, the target agent. This scalable agent represents all of the Tornado tools on the target system.
The Tornado tools interact with each other and with the target system. They also have the sophisticated WindPower GUI for point-and-click ease of use, including pull-down menus, scroll bars and buttons -- eliminating dependency on command-line interfaces.
"Tornado brings a new level of functionality and productivity to the embedded market. Its integrated and extensible framework gives developers the opportunity to plug-in and use the diverse set of tools necessary to bring today's complex projects to market," said Jim Reinhart, Motorola's Manager of Embedded Systems Engineering and Marketing. "We are very excited that Motorola processors are featured in the first wave of Tornado -- teaming together to offer a great platform for the embedded system developer."
Published APIs for A Truly Open Extensible Plug-In Environment
To provide both third-party vendors and customers with an open extensible development environment, Tornado supports a wide variety of published application programming interfaces (APIs). These APIs facilitate easy third-party tool integration, greater customization of the user interface, additional connection strategies, and development of application-specific tools.
Most Recent Business Articles
- Multiple criteria evaluation and optimization of transportation systems
- Multi-criteria analysis procedure for sustainable mobility evaluation in urban areas
- A two-leveled multi-objective symbiotic evolutionary algorithm for the hub and spoke location problem
- Multi-criteria analysis for evaluating the impacts of intelligent speed adaptation
- The development of Taiwan arterial traffic-adaptive signal control system and its field test: a Taiwan experience
Most Recent Business Publications
Most Popular Business Articles
- 7 tips for effective listening: productive listening does not occur naturally. It requires hard work and practice - Back To Basics - effective listening is a crucial skill for internal auditors
- FAS 109: a primer for non-accountants - Financial Accounting Standards Board's "Statement 109: Accounting for Income Taxes"
- LIFO vs. FIFO: a return to the basics
- Design a commission plan that drives sales - Sales Commissions
- Too Young to Rent a Car? - 25-years-old the minimum age for car renting - Brief Article



